Are people in Belding older or younger than people in Forest Hills?
- The Median Age in Belding is 6.6 years younger than in Forest Hills.
Are housing costs cheaper in Belding or Forest Hills?
- Belding
housing
costs are 52.2% less expensive than Forest Hills housing costs.
Which city has a longer commute, Belding or Forest Hills?
- The average commute for residents of Belding is 11.4 minutes longer than it is for residents of Forest Hills.
Things to do in Forest Hills?
An established small town just outside Grand Rapids in Kent County. Beautiful trees line the neighborhoods here giving it a distinct wooded feel while still staying close to all that Grand Rapids has to offer. There are excellent schools, parks and many shopping opportunities in Forest Hills.
Things to do in Belding?
Belding, Michigan is a small city located in the Lower Peninsula of the state. It has a population of around 5,500 people and is nestled in the Grand River Valley. The town has a rich history with buildings from the 1800s still standing. Living in Belding is peaceful and relaxed, with quiet streets and friendly neighbors. During summer months, residents enjoy outdoor activities like camping, fishing, basketball and golfing at one of the many nearby lakes or county parks. The community often comes together for local events such as farmers markets, festivals and concerts in the park. With its charming atmosphere and close-knit community spirit, Belding provides an ideal place to live for those looking for a tranquil hometown atmosphere.
